Clinical Immunology in Auckland is a branch of medicine that covers disorders of the
immune system
and is practised by an
Immunologist
.
Immune diseases
fall into two main categories:
Autoimmune Disease
where autoimmunity is caused by an
overactive immune system
, examples include Type 1 Diabetes, Arthritis, Mulitple Sclerosis, Lupus and Psoriasis and
Immune Deficiency
; where the body has an insufficient immune response to the presence of bacteria or a virus. Examples of an
immunodefiency disease
are HIV/AIDS, Leukemia, Viral Hepatitis and Anemia. There are several other branches in the field of
immunology
such as
Reproductive Immunology
,
Cancer Immunology
,
Developmental Immunology
and
Diagnostic Immunology
-
